5. When finding a vehicle in the opposite direction having difficulty to go forward and needing to borrow road while crossing each other, the driver should ________.

A. Not occupy the road of the other side and should go forward normally

B. Indicate the other side to stop and yield

C. Speed up and go forward by the right side

D. Yield to the other side as much as possible

Answer:D

8. A motorized vehicle driver who drives after drinking is subject to a 12-point penalty.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er:A

11. When driving on a road covered by ice and snow, the driver must reduce speed and increase the safe distance.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er:A

16. A motorized vehicle driver who drives after drinking is subject to a ________.

A. 3-point penalty

B. 2-point penalty

C. 6-point penalty

D. 12-point penalty

Answer:D

18. When a vehicle passes a curve on a mountain road, the driver should reduce speed, honk and stick to the right.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er:A

19. If a motorized vehicle causes a traffic accident on the expressway and cannot to run normally, the vehicle should be towed by a rescue vehicle or a tow truck.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er:A

20. When driving in windy, rainy, snowy, foggy and other complex weather conditions, the driver should turn on the head light, honk continuously and overtake rapidly if the vehicle in front goes slowly.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er:B

21. When a vehicle reaches a muddy or burst-and-muddy section, the driver should stop,observe and select the level and solid section or the section with vehicle tracks.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er:A

23. When a vehicle starts up, the driver should observe the traffic conditions and begin to start up after making sure it is safe to do so.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er:A

25. When driving a vehicle through an inundated road with non-motorized vehicles on both sides, the driver should _________.

A. Reduce speed and go slowly

B. Go forward normally

C. Speed up and pass

D. Continuously honk

Answer:A
